Miami Stories Coordinator – Part Time

Supervisor – Folklife Curator

Project-oriented position with the objective to maintain and enhance the Miami Stories initiative

  • Manage regular publishing schedule for Miami Stories in different formats
  • Monitor online written submissions and upload stories to the webpage
  • Submit monthly social media story features to Social Media Coordinator
  • Submit monthly Miami Herald story submission
  • Manage the Miami Stories Recording Booth and record interviews at outreach events at no more than two events per month
  • Process and upload recorded stories to the Soundcloud audio archive
  • Compile annual report on all published stories
  • Conduct one-off interviews with specific individuals identified by museum staff
  • Evaluate/determine new uses for stories
  • Seek collaborations within the community

Desired Skills and Experience:

  • Bachelor’s degree, preferably in Journalism, Anthropology, Folklore, or History
  • Interviewing skills
  • Audio editing experience
  • Ability to handle multiple projects at a time and work on a deadline
